from __future__ import division
from panda3d.core import LVecBase2i, Vec2
from rpcore.render_stage import RenderStage
from rpcore.stages.ambient_stage import AmbientStage
class VXGIStage(RenderStage):
required_inputs = ["voxelGridPosition"]
required_pipes = ["ShadedScene", "SceneVoxels", "GBuffer", "ScatteringIBLSpecular",
"ScatteringIBLDiffuse", "PreviousFrame::VXGIPostSample",
"CombinedVelocity", "PreviousFrame::SceneDepth"]
@property
def produced_pipes(self):
return {
# "VXGISpecular": self.target_spec.color_tex,
"VXGIDiffuse": self.target_resolve.color_tex,
"VXGIPostSample": self.target_resolve.color_tex
}
def create(self):
# Create a target for the specular GI
# self.target_spec = self.create_target("SpecularGI")
# self.target_spec.add_color_attachment(bits=16, alpha=True)
# self.target_spec.prepare_buffer()
# Create a target for the diffuse GI
self.target_diff = self.create_target("DiffuseGI")
self.target_diff.size = -2
self.target_diff.add_color_attachment(bits=16)
self.target_diff.prepare_buffer()
# Create the target which blurs the diffuse result
self.target_blur_v = self.create_target("BlurV")
self.target_blur_v.size = -2
self.target_blur_v.add_color_attachment(bits=16)
self.target_blur_v.has_color_alpha = True
self.target_blur_v.prepare_buffer()
self.target_blur_v.set_shader_input("SourceTex", self.target_diff.color_tex)
self.target_blur_h = self.create_target("BlurH")
self.target_blur_h.size = -2
self.target_blur_h.add_color_attachment(bits=16)
self.target_blur_h.has_color_alpha = True
self.target_blur_h.prepare_buffer()
self.target_blur_h.set_shader_input("SourceTex", self.target_blur_v.color_tex)
# Set blur parameters
self.target_blur_v.set_shader_input("blur_direction", LVecBase2i(0, 1))
self.target_blur_h.set_shader_input("blur_direction", LVecBase2i(1, 0))
# Create the target which bilateral upsamples the diffuse target
self.target_upscale_diff = self.create_target("UpscaleDiffuse")
self.target_upscale_diff.add_color_attachment(bits=16)
self.target_upscale_diff.prepare_buffer()
self.target_upscale_diff.set_shader_inputs(
SourceTex=self.target_blur_h.color_tex,
upscaleWeights=Vec2(0.0001, 0.001))
self.target_resolve = self.create_target("ResolveVXGI")
self.target_resolve.add_color_attachment(bits=16)
self.target_resolve.prepare_buffer()
self.target_resolve.set_shader_input("CurrentTex", self.target_upscale_diff.color_tex)
# Make the ambient stage use the GI result
AmbientStage.required_pipes += ["VXGIDiffuse"]
def reload_shaders(self):
# self.target_spec.shader = self.load_plugin_shader("vxgi_specular.frag.glsl")
self.target_diff.shader = self.load_plugin_shader("vxgi_diffuse.frag.glsl")
self.target_upscale_diff.shader = self.load_plugin_shader(
"/$$rp/shader/bilateral_upscale.frag.glsl")
blur_shader = self.load_plugin_shader(
"/$$rp/shader/bilateral_halfres_blur.frag.glsl")
self.target_blur_v.shader = blur_shader
self.target_blur_h.shader = blur_shader
self.target_resolve.shader = self.load_plugin_shader("resolve_vxgi.frag.glsl")
